How to Prevent Security Breaches in E-Commerce Websites

How to Prevent Security Breaches in E-Commerce Websites

E-commerce platforms have become prime targets for cybercriminals due to the sensitive information they handle. To safeguard customer data and ensure a secure shopping experience, it is essential to implement robust security measures. Below are effective strategies to prevent security breaches in e-commerce websites.

1. Use HTTPS Protocol

One of the fundamental steps in securing an e-commerce website is enabling HTTPS. This protocol encrypts data exchanged between the user’s browser and your server, making it difficult for hackers to intercept sensitive information, such as credit card details. Implementing an SSL certificate is a must in today’s digital landscape.

2. Regularly Update Software and Plugins

Keeping your website software, including content management systems (CMS), plugins, and themes, up to date is crucial. Cybercriminals often exploit vulnerabilities in outdated software. Schedule regular updates and monitor plugin vulnerabilities to maintain a secure online store.

3. Implement Strong Password Policies

Encouraging the use of strong passwords can significantly reduce the risk of unauthorized access. Use a combination of letters, numbers, and special characters, and mandate periodic password changes. Educating users about the importance of password security is also essential.

4. Conduct Regular Security Audits

Performing regular security audits helps identify any vulnerabilities in your e-commerce website. Utilize security tools to scan for potential threats and hire cybersecurity professionals for comprehensive assessments. Address any findings promptly to mitigate risks.

5. Utilize Firewalls and Intrusion Detection Systems

Installing web application firewalls (WAF) can help monitor and filter malicious traffic before it reaches your server. Additionally, intrusion detection systems (IDS) can alert you to suspicious activity, allowing for quick action to prevent breaches.

6. Secure Payment Processing

Use secure payment gateways that comply with PCI DSS (Payment Card Industry Data Security Standard) standards. These gateways encrypt payment information and help in securing transactions against fraud. Avoid storing sensitive payment details on your server to minimize risk.

7. Implement Two-Factor Authentication (2FA)

Two-factor authentication adds an extra layer of security by requiring users to verify their identity through an additional method, such as a text message or authentication app. This can significantly reduce the likelihood of unauthorized access to user accounts.

8. Educate Employees on Security Best Practices

Human error is often a weak link in security. Provide employees with training on cybersecurity best practices, including recognizing phishing attempts and handling sensitive information properly. Keeping your team informed can enhance overall security.

9. Maintain Regular Backups

Regularly backing up your website ensures that you can quickly recover from a data breach or cyberattack. Store backups in a secure location and test restoration processes to ensure they function correctly when needed.

10. Monitor for Breaches

Invest in security monitoring tools that alert you to potential breaches in real-time. This proactive approach allows for swift action, potentially limiting damage and protecting your customers’ information.

By implementing these security measures, e-commerce websites can significantly reduce the risk of security breaches and provide a safer shopping environment for their customers. Prioritizing cybersecurity not only protects sensitive data but also enhances customer trust and loyalty.